Why Your Next Big Move Should Be DevOps as a Service

Rethinking the DevOps Journey

In the past, adopting DevOps meant a lot of groundwork—buying tools, training teams, and reworking processes. It worked, but it took time, money, and constant upkeep.

DaaS changes the game. Instead of building everything from scratch, you tap into an expert-driven, fully managed system that is ready to roll from day one. You get the benefits—automation, speed, security—without the pain of doing all the heavy lifting yourself.

What Makes DevOps as a Service Different?

The core DevOps ideas are still the same: streamline processes, collaborate better, and release faster. The difference is, with DaaS, you do not need to assemble the entire engine—it is already built, tested, and ready to drive.

Here is what that means for you:

  • Faster adoption – Skip the long setup phase and start seeing results quickly.

  • Best practices included – Security, monitoring, and compliance are part of the deal.

  • Scale as you grow – Add more capacity without stress when your needs change.

The Real-World Advantages

1. Faster, More Confident Releases
Automation takes care of repetitive tasks, so new features roll out in hours instead of weeks—and you can be confident they will work.

2. Consistency Across Environments
Using containers and orchestration tools like Kubernetes keeps your app’s behavior predictable from testing to production.

3. Cost Efficiency Without Compromise
You get access to expert tools and skills without hiring a full in-house team or investing in expensive infrastructure.

4. Proactive Security
Security checks and monitoring run alongside development, so issues get caught before they become problems.

5. Better Team Collaboration
Everyone—developers, testers, and ops—works on the same page with full visibility into progress and priorities.

 

The Technology That Makes It Work

  • CI/CD Pipeline as a Service – Your builds, tests, and deployments run automatically, with the ability to roll back instantly if needed.

  • Containers and Kubernetes – Portable, consistent, and ready to scale whenever your workload grows.

  • Infrastructure as Code (IaC) – Deploy and manage environments just like software, reducing human errors and speeding up changes.

When DevOps as a Service Makes the Most Sense

  • Startups that need to get products to market quickly without building a big IT team.

  • Established companies modernizing old systems for better speed and flexibility.

  • Seasonal businesses that need quick scaling during peak demand.

  • Highly regulated industries where security and compliance cannot be compromised.
